1 Chronicles 11:22-37 Holman Christian Standard Bible (HCSB)

22. Benaiah son of Jehoiada was the son of a brave man from Kabzeel, a man of many exploits. Benaiah killed two sons of Ariel of Moab, and he went down into a pit on a snowy day and killed a lion.

23. He also killed an Egyptian who was seven and a half feet tall. Even though the Egyptian had a spear in his hand like a weaver’s beam, Benaiah went down to him with a club, snatched the spear out of the Egyptian’s hand, and then killed him with his own spear.

24. These were the exploits of Benaiah son of Jehoiada, who had a reputation among the three warriors.

25. He was the most honored of the Thirty, but he did not become one of the Three. David put him in charge of his bodyguard.

26. The fighting men were:Joab’s brother Asahel, Elhanan son of Dodo of Bethlehem,

27. Shammoth the Harorite,Helez the Pelonite,

28. Ira son of Ikkesh the Tekoite,Abiezer the Anathothite,

29. Sibbecai the Hushathite,Ilai the Ahohite,

30. Maharai the Netophathite,Heled son of Baanah the Netophathite,

31. Ithai son of Ribai from Gibeah of the Benjaminites,Benaiah the Pirathonite,

32. Hurai from the wadis of Gaash,Abiel the Arbathite,

33. Azmaveth the Baharumite,Eliahba the Shaalbonite,

34. the sons of Hashem the Gizonite,Jonathan son of Shagee the Hararite,

35. Ahiam son of Sachar the Hararite,Eliphal son of Ur,

36. Hepher the Mecherathite,Ahijah the Pelonite,

37. Hezro the Carmelite,Naarai son of Ezbai,
